I hadn’t realized. Are you using the ‘Add Item’ form in a Wanted List? (Or
something else I don’t know about?)
Because it’s really not the best tool and why you’re frustrated with it. It’s
indeed very backward, going down the catalogue’s structure: type » category »
item.
A simple search and then using the ‘Add to My WL’ link on the part’s page is
way simpler.
Though you need to fill some fields each time you click the link, you can open
multiple part pages and ‘batch’ the addings.
Or you use the ❤️ (hearts) in inventories (the tab in the set’s page, not the
standalone page) if you want parts from a set.
